How they compare

Japan currently reports 789.49 kt against 95.59 kt in Côte d'Ivoire, a difference of 693.9 kt.

That makes Japan's figure about 8.3 times Côte d'Ivoire's.

Across all 34 years both countries report, Japan has been ahead every year.

Côte d'Ivoire ranks 25th and Japan ranks 24th of 32 countries.

Japan has averaged higher in every one of the 4 decades both report.

Head to head by decade

Decade Côte d'Ivoire Japan Difference Ahead
1990s 85.26 kt 988.95 kt 903.69 kt Japan
2000s 93.62 kt 946.13 kt 852.51 kt Japan
2010s 94.97 kt 816.83 kt 721.86 kt Japan
2020s 95.54 kt 791.89 kt 696.35 kt Japan

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
